Output 70c188c93c54f629888484a6e8f3d009a9e1603cc289c4f95244b809ed5449b8:179

value
51629
script pubkey
OP_0 OP_PUSHBYTES_20 f02c58b5777a4d5d99818d02a5d20fb941729fd7
address
bc1q7qk93dth0fx4mxvp35p2t5s0h9qh987hh9u2wv
transaction
70c188c93c54f629888484a6e8f3d009a9e1603cc289c4f95244b809ed5449b8
confirmations
43933
spent
true